Discipleship was never meant to be shallow, hurried, or theoretical. It was meant to shape a life.As a natural follow-up to Be One-Make One, this book invites readers to go deeper into what it truly means to live as a disciple of Jesus Christ. Rather than presenting discipleship as a program or checklist, it explores it as a lifelong journey of formation, obedience, and faithful endurance.Rooted in Scripture and shaped by decades of life-on-life ministry experience, this book addresses both the inner and outer life of the disciple-union with Christ, adoption and sonship, freedom from shame and condemnation, abiding in Christ, life in the Holy Spirit, spiritual gifts, perseverance through suffering, generational faith, and leaving a lasting legacy.Written with pastoral clarity and practical application, each chapter includes reflection questions and prayer prompts, making it ideal for personal growth, small groups, house churches, and leadership development.This is a book for believers who desire more than information-for those who long for transformation and a faith that endures and multiplies.The call still stands.The journey continues.And the fruit is meant to last.
